No one ever really knows what goes in another person’s life, especially when it comes to celebrities.
Actress Jennifer Aniston would likely agree.

“All the years and years and years of speculation…
It was really hard.
I was going through IVF, drinking Chinese teas, you name it,” she shared.

These days, she has to come to accept that she will never be a mother.
However, she wishes she was given other options when she was younger.
“I would’ve given anything if someone had said to me, ‘Freeze your eggs.
Do yourself a favor.’
You just don’t think it.
So here I am today.
The ship has sailed,” the 53-year-old said.
Aniston says it was a painful process made even more difficult by what was being said in the media.
“I just cared about my career.
And God forbid a woman is successful and doesn’t have a child.
It was absolute lies.
I don’t have anything to hide at this point,” she insisted.
In 2016, Aniston wrote an op-ed forHuff Postentitled “For The Record, I Am Not Pregnant.
She wrote, “The objectification and scrutiny we put women through is absurd and disturbing.”
